Specifications

  • Brand: Patriot manufactures this SSD, known for storage and memory products.
  • Series: Part of the Viper VP4300 Lite series optimized for high-speed storage.
  • Capacity: Offers 500GB of internal storage suitable for games and applications.
  • Form Factor: Uses the M.2 2280 form factor for compact installation in PCs.
  • Interface: Connects via PCIe Gen4 x4 for high-speed data transfer.
  • Protocol: Supports NVMe 2.0 protocol for modern storage performance.
  • Sequential Read: Provides up to 7,000MB/s sequential read speeds for fast data access.
  • Sequential Write: Offers up to 4,000MB/s sequential write speeds for efficient file transfers.
  • Compatibility: Compatible with PC platforms and expandable PS5 storage.
  • Warranty: Includes a 5-year warranty covering manufacturing defects.
  • Weight: Lightweight at 1.06 ounces for easy handling and installation.
  • Dimensions: Measures 2.36 x 2.36 x 1.18 inches for standard M.2 slots.

FAQ

This SSD features a 500GB capacity, M.2 2280 form factor, PCIe Gen4 x4 interface, and NVMe 2.0 protocol, offering sequential read speeds up to 7,000MB/s and write speeds up to 4,000MB/s for fast performance.

Yes, the Viper VP4300 Lite is compatible with PS5 expansion storage, but make sure your console has the latest firmware updates and adequate space for installation.

This device works with motherboards that support M.2 PCIe Gen4 x4 slots. On older PCIe Gen3 boards, it will function but at Gen3 speeds rather than full Gen4 performance.

Installation is straightforward. Simply insert the drive into an available M.2 slot, secure it with the mounting screw, and format it using your OS. No additional tools or software are required.

Users report that this device maintains low heat under typical workloads. While intense, sustained transfers may raise temperatures slightly, it generally remains stable without needing extra cooling.

It offers a 5-year warranty and solid build quality. Feedback indicates that it handles everyday gaming and desktop usage reliably, with minimal risk of failure under normal conditions.

On PCIe Gen3 motherboards, the SSD will operate at Gen3 speeds, reducing maximum throughput. Users on older systems may not experience the full 7,000MB/s read speed but will still see improvements over SATA SSDs.

No special software is required to maintain this device. Standard OS disk management and firmware updates are sufficient to ensure stable performance.
